Ingredients:
- 2 lbs ground beef (80/20 blend)
- 1 large yellow onion, finely diced
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tsp fine sea salt
- 1/2 tsp coarsely ground black pepper
- 1.5 cups Thousand Island dressing
- 1/2 cup dill pickles, diced small
- 2 cups sharp cheddar cheese, shredded
- 1 tbsp yellow mustard
- 32 oz frozen tater tots
- 2 cups iceberg lettuce, shredded
- 1 tbsp toasted sesame seeds
Instructions:
-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). In a large skillet over medium-high heat, brown the ground beef with the diced onions. Break the meat into small crumbles and sauté until mahogany-colored and onions are translucent.
- Drain the excess fat thoroughly in a colander. Return the drained beef to the pan and stir in the minced garlic, salt, pepper, yellow mustard, and 1/2 cup of the Thousand Island dressing.
- Transfer the beef mixture into the bottom of a 9x13 inch baking dish, pressing it into an even layer. Spread the diced pickles over the beef, followed by a layer of shredded cheddar cheese.
- Arrange the frozen tater tots in a single, even layer over the cheese. Place in the oven and bake for 30 minutes until the tots are golden brown and extra crispy.
- Remove from oven. Drizzle the remaining 1/2 cup of Thousand Island dressing over the hot tots. Top with shredded iceberg lettuce, toasted sesame seeds, and additional pickles before serving.
